Windows Server Core• Nearly Win32 Compatible• Same behaviour of Windows• Install all of the same tooling
![Page 19: The How and Why of Windows containers](https://reader035.vdocuments.mx/reader035/viewer/2022062223/586e8c3f1a28aba0038b83c7/html5/thumbnails/19.jpg)
Windows Nano• Stripped down• Smallest footprint• 1/20th the size of Windows Server Core• Only essential components– Hyper-V, Clustering, Networking, Storage, .Net,
Core CLR

Installing Windows Containers
![Page 22: The How and Why of Windows containers](https://reader035.vdocuments.mx/reader035/viewer/2022062223/586e8c3f1a28aba0038b83c7/html5/thumbnails/22.jpg)
C:\> Install-WindowsFeature containers
C:\> wget -uri https://aka.ms/tp5/Install-ContainerHost -OutFile C:\Install-ContainerHost.ps1
C:\> powershell.exe -NoProfile C:\Install-ContainerHost.ps1
![Page 23: The How and Why of Windows containers](https://reader035.vdocuments.mx/reader035/viewer/2022062223/586e8c3f1a28aba0038b83c7/html5/thumbnails/23.jpg)
C:\> Install-WindowsFeature containers
C:\> Invoke-WebRequest "https://get.docker.com/builds/Windows/x86_64/docker-1.12.0.zip" -OutFile "$env:TEMP\docker-1.12.0.zip" -UseBasicParsing
C:\> dockerd --register-serviceC:\> Start-Service Docker

C:\SourceCode\App> type Dockerfile
FROM microsoft/iis:10
RUN echo "Hello World - Dockerfile" > c:\inetpub\wwwroot\index.html
![Page 43: The How and Why of Windows containers](https://reader035.vdocuments.mx/reader035/viewer/2022062223/586e8c3f1a28aba0038b83c7/html5/thumbnails/43.jpg)
C:\SourceCode> docker build –t app .
PS C:\> docker imagesREPOSITORY TAG IMAGE ID CREATEDapp latest k23jjin423d 1 minutes ago iis 10 as4w9c928829 9 minutes ago windowsservercore 10.0.10586.0 6801d964fda5 2 weeks ago windowsservercore latest 6801d964fda5 2 weeks ago nanoserver 10.0.10586.0 8572198a60f1 2 weeks ago nanoserver latest 8572198a60f1 2 weeks ago

Windows Hyper-V Isolation• Problem: Shared Kernel• Solution: Super lightweight virtual machines
• Intel Clear Containers• Ubuntu LXD• IBM are working on something
![Page 67: The How and Why of Windows containers](https://reader035.vdocuments.mx/reader035/viewer/2022062223/586e8c3f1a28aba0038b83c7/html5/thumbnails/67.jpg)
PS C:\> docker run -it -p 80:80 \ --isolation=hyperv app cmd
1) Windows starts 'Utility VM‘ and freezes state2) Forks VM state, brings up a fresh second VM3) Launches container on VM
![Page 68: The How and Why of Windows containers](https://reader035.vdocuments.mx/reader035/viewer/2022062223/586e8c3f1a28aba0038b83c7/html5/thumbnails/68.jpg)
Properties of Windows Utility VM• Invisible to Docker and containers• All writes are degraded• Separate Kernel to host• SMB file share to access host data
• In the future used for Linux containers?
